Local kernel corruption via shared NFC local object
Published Feb 29, 2024 · Updated Aug 5, 2026
Use-after-free in affected Linux kernel NFC LLCP builds allows local users to corrupt kernel memory through crafted socket operations. The llcp_sock_bind and llcp_sock_connect paths can assign one nfc_llcp_local object to two sockets; closing the first drops the shared reference while the second socket retains the freed pointer. A local low-privileged process must create and bind or connect multiple AF_NFC LLCP sockets to the same local object, after which socket teardown can crash the kernel or compromise kernel execution.
